Rainbows help to clean town streets
RAINBOWS from 12th Rossendale (St James the Less) group enjoyed a visit from members of Civic Pride.
The group of 18 girls learned about litter and its effect on the environment.
They then put what they learnt into practice outside - collecting four bags of litter from streets from the pavements and verges around St James the Less Church, Rawtenstall.
Rainbows, celebrating their 30th birthday this year, are a section of Girlguiding for young girls aged five to seven.
